Output 3186bcf33e7efcdd42e3af43585e1cdfbf3d11f2eb40ea7ad0c04066f0cb9427:1

value
2691846
script pubkey
OP_0 OP_PUSHBYTES_20 50dc9240f01d300f2821e679675d4982a5fead9f
address
bc1q2rwfys8sr5cq72ppueukwh2fs2jlatvll62x68
transaction
3186bcf33e7efcdd42e3af43585e1cdfbf3d11f2eb40ea7ad0c04066f0cb9427
spent
true